Build agents in the Korvane pool drift. NTP sync runs hourly, but skew over 30 seconds breaks artifact signing on the Pellit pipeline. Check agent clocks before debugging anything else. The drift monitor reports to the Shard dashboard and needs an auth credential to push metrics. Add the following line to the agent's env file.

env line for baguf-fajop: VAULT_KEY29=55a9f564d54882bbe7acf5741bf1a

Subject: Hardware lab access this week

Hi front desk team,

Technicians from Quillon Systems will be visiting the hardware lab on Level 3 through Friday. Please check them in as normal, issue visitor lanyards, and walk them to the lab door the first time only. The lab steward, Petra, is usually in by 09:00. If she is unavailable, the door code they should enter is below.

turnstile pass: bdg-FVNQRS-72965873

## Step 2: Wire your plugin into the consent banner

Heads up, plugin folks: the new Bannerly consent flow in Quillcart 4 fires a consent-changed event before your plugin loads, so don't assume storage access at init. Register your purposes with the manifest hook instead, and gate any tracking calls behind the granted check. Testing locally? Spin up the sandbox profile first. Then drop the following settings into your plugin's environment so the banner recognizes you.

service settings:
[casax]
port = 6379
team = rusir
host = casax.zemvarhq.corp
region = outer-4
access_code = ac_9808ce
timeout_ms = 1500

Scope: the Vantler admin dashboard theme service. Dark mode is toggled per-tenant, not per-user. If a tenant reports washed-out charts or unreadable labels, first confirm the theme service is serving the v2 palette — v1 lacks dark tokens entirely. Restart the theme pod after any palette change; it caches aggressively. Do not edit palettes in prod directly; change the config and redeploy. Screenshots of expected contrast live in the team wiki. The theme service ships with the following default configuration.

service settings:
PRAIX_LOG_LEVEL=error
PRAIX_METRICS_HOST=metrics.praix.qorvelcorp.corp
PRAIX_POOL_SIZE=16